NEW DELHI: India’s run-machine Virat Kohli was given rest for India’s final Asia Cup ‘Super 4’ encounter against Bangladesh on Friday. Given that the match was a dead rubber with India and Sri Lanka already confirmed as the two finalists, the team management opted to rest not only Virat but also Jasprit Bumrah, Hardik Pandya, Kuldeep Yadav and Mohammed Siraj.
In their absence, the Playing XI against Bangladesh featured Suryakumar Yadav, Tilak Varma, who made his debut, Shardul Thakur, Mohammed Shami and Prasidh Krishna.
During the match, Virat was seen in the role of drinks carrier for his teammates.

Additionally, Virat had an amusing encounter with the Super-Sopper operator before the match against Bangladesh.
While he was standing near the boundary ropes, the groundsman playfully startled him by blowing the horn, nearly catching Virat off guard.

India face Sri Lanka in the Asia Cup final at the R Premadasa Stadium in Colombo on Sunday.
The cricketing giants have 13 Asian titles (across T20s & ODIs) between them. India have seven Asia Cup titles to their name – 1984, 1988, 1990–91, 1995, 2010, 2016, and 2018.
Sri Lanka clinched the prestigious titles in 1986, 1997, 2004, 2008, 2014, and most recently in 2022.
